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: A Laboratory Manual of Analytical Methods of Protein Chemistry, Volume 5 presents the laboratory techniques for protein and polypeptide study. This book discusses the staining procedure for histones, which has a high degree of selectivity for basic proteins and the unique ability to visualize qualitative differences in terms of color changes. Organized into four chapters, this volume begins with an overview of the formalin-mediated ammoniacal-silver staining procedure as a selective stain for basic proteins and its application per cell and per extract. This text then examines the optical rotatory dispersion (ORD), which has advanced into a powerful tool for describing the conformations and conformational changes of biopolymers. Other chapters consider the application of ultrasensitive calorimetry to thermodynamic problems. This book discusses as well the principle of the technique, its instrumentation, and experimental procedures. The final chapter deals with the hydrodynamic densities and preferential hydration values for protein precipitates in concentrated salt solutions. This book is a valuable resource for chemists and biochemists.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Thrombosis and Bleeding Disorders compiles the laboratory and research aspects of thrombosis and hemorrhagic disorders in humans. This book presents reviews of the underlying theory, physiology, and biochemistry of hemostasis and thrombosis, including the enzymology of blood coagulation and fibrinolysis. This compilation is divided into three levels of specific purposes. First is to provide the most reliable and widely accepted laboratory assays of undisputed diagnostic clinical value, which provides newcomers in the field and experienced workers in the coagulation laboratory with a reference manual to everyday work in a clinically-oriented environment. Second is to review and sketch in outline the theoretical sections focusing on mechanisms. Finally, this text aims to include a systematic review of the most successful purification techniques for individual coagulation factors and moieties of the fibrinolytic enzyme system. This publication is beneficial to medical students and clinicians concerned with human blood coagulation.
